TM 9-2320-364-20-3 2-2220 Replace air reservoirs (Para 12-27 through 12-31).  Verify repair, go to Step 5 of this Fault. 5.  AIR PRESSURE DROPS RAPIDLY AFTER ENGINE SHUTDOWN (CONT). Drain valves OK. Air lines and fittings OK. Air inlet check valves OK. Air reservoirs OK. KNOWN INFO POSSIBLE PROBLEMS TEST OPTIONS REASON FOR QUESTION Verify repair. If air pressure stays at 125 4 psi (861 28 kPa) after engine shutdown, fault has been corrected. NO Fault not corrected. Notify DS Maintenance. 5. Does air pressure stay at 125 4 psi (861 28 kPa) after engine shutdown? Fault corrected. 4. YES NO Drain valves OK. Air lines and fittings OK. Air inlet check valves OK. Cracked or damaged air   reservoirs. KNOWN INFO POSSIBLE PROBLEMS TEST OPTIONS REASON FOR QUESTION Visual inspection. Audible inspection. Air pressure will drop rapidly after engine shut down if air reservoirs are cracked or damaged. Are air reservoirs free of cracks or damage? YES
